Compare all specifications:
2005 Chrysler 300 | 2010 Toyota Highlander | |
Make | Chrysler | Toyota |
Model | 300 | Highlander |
Year Released | 2005 | 2010 |
Body Type | Sedan |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 3516 cc | 3500 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 250 HP | 270 HP |
Engine RPM | 6400 RPM | 6200 RPM |
Torque | 340 Nm | 336 Nm |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 7 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1709 kg | 1835 kg |
Vehicle Length | 5010 mm | 4785 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1890 mm | 1910 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1490 mm | 1760 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3190 mm | 2789 mm |
Fuel Consumption | 8.7 L/100km | 9.8 L/100km |
Fuel Consumption City | 12.4 L/100km | 13.1 L/100km |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 68 L | 73 L |
